Made from recycled and regenerated fabric, which the majority derives from post consumer plastic bottles. All plastic is recycled into performance fibers.
Internal lining: Composed of 82% Recycled Nylon and 18% Spandex. Rib: 83% Recycled Polyester
17%Spandex.
Global Recycled Standard and Control Union certified.
